117.info
人生若只如初见

如何优化nftables在Ubuntu中的规则执行效率

要优化nftables 在Ubuntu 中的规则执行效率,可以考虑以下几点:

  1. 精简规则集:尽量避免使用过多复杂的规则,只保留必要的规则。删除不必要的规则可以减少规则匹配的时间,提高执行效率。

  2. 使用合适的数据结构:在编写规则时,选择适合场景的数据结构可以提高规则匹配的效率。例如,使用哈希表来加快匹配速度。

  3. 避免重复匹配:尽量避免在规则中重复匹配相同的数据包。可以通过合并规则或者使用流量分类等技术来减少冗余匹配。

  4. 避免使用复杂的匹配条件:尽量避免使用复杂的匹配条件,例如正则表达式等。可以通过简化规则来提高执行效率。

  5. 使用连接跟踪:连接跟踪可以帮助识别和跟踪网络连接,减少不必要的规则匹配。合理使用连接跟踪可以提高规则执行效率。

  6. 定期检查规则集:定期检查规则集,删除过期或者不必要的规则,保持规则集的简洁和高效。

通过以上方法,可以提高nftables 在Ubuntu 中的规则执行效率,提升网络性能和安全保障。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fea29AzsAAQdXDQ.html

推荐文章

  • Ubuntu Swapper对硬盘寿命有影响吗

    Ubuntu Swapper对硬盘寿命的影响是一个复杂的问题,需要从多个角度来分析。
    Ubuntu Swapper对硬盘寿命的影响
    Ubuntu Swapper是Ubuntu系统中用于虚拟内...

  • Apache2 URL重写规则怎么写

    在Apache服务器中,URL重写通常是通过使用mod_rewrite模块来实现的。这个模块允许你根据特定的规则修改请求的URL。以下是一些基本的步骤和示例,帮助你编写Apach...

  • Ubuntu DHCP服务器如何配置子网掩码

    在Ubuntu上配置DHCP服务器的子网掩码,你需要编辑DHCP服务器的配置文件。以下是详细步骤:
    1. 安装DHCP服务器
    如果你还没有安装DHCP服务器,可以使用以...

  • Ubuntu OpenSSL版本如何更新

    在Ubuntu系统中更新OpenSSL版本可以通过以下几种方法:
    使用APT包管理器更新
    Ubuntu提供了APT包管理器来简化软件包的安装和更新过程。要使用APT更新Op...

  • 在Ubuntu中使用nftables进行故障排除的方法有哪些

    在Ubuntu中使用nftables进行故障排除的方法可以包括以下几种: 检查nftables配置文件:首先检查nftables的配置文件,通常位于/etc/nftables.conf或/etc/nftables...

  • Ubuntu中nftables的安全策略如何设置

    在Ubuntu中设置nftables的安全策略需要编辑nftables规则集,可以通过以下步骤进行设置: 安装nftables:
    sudo apt-get install nftables 创建一个nftables规...

  • 如何使用nftables在Ubuntu中实现NAT转换

    要在Ubuntu中使用nftables实现NAT转换,您可以按照以下步骤操作: 安装nftables: 首先,您需要安装nftables软件包。在终端中运行以下命令来安装nftables:

  • Ubuntu下nftables的规则集管理方法有哪些

    在Ubuntu下,可以使用nft命令行工具来管理nftables规则集。以下是一些常用的nftables规则集管理方法: 创建一个新的规则集: sudo nft add table ip filter 添加...